Transaction 0315c62feae24ad57d0c3a4944572f71165a2d0c2a98446c2fe7d39c9559289a
1 Input
1 Output
-
0315c62feae24ad57d0c3a4944572f71165a2d0c2a98446c2fe7d39c9559289a:0
- value
- 3422400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 522d8448b4a95a3e148980ab05cb45666b3a66df OP_EQUAL
- address
- 39BXrqD6Qb7GjvZUCybbeWWqQvDAFveXB6